About Carrie Castro at a glance

Carrie Castro is a personal injury, criminal defense, business, tax, and litigation attorney based in Merrillville, Indiana. They have 20+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 2006. Admitted to practice in Indiana (2006), Texas (2017), and Kentucky (2018). Educated at Valparaiso University (J.D., 2005). Provides legal services in Spanish. Serands clients in Merrillville, IN and the surrounding metropolitan area.

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in Indiana

Practicing law in Indiana. Legal matters in Indiana are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Merrillville are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Indiana state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Indiana br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Indiana cour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
